A fishing license is required for both Florida residents and visitors, though licenses are provided if you take a charter. Licenses can be purchased at an outfitter or by calling 888-347-4356. Web508 followers. 34 spots. Known as the Heart of the Florida Keys,,” Marathon is a small city located on Vaca Key at the midpoint of the Keys island chain. Fort Myers Beach is a small beach town on Estero Island that was only incorporated in 1995.
